The president of the Cameroonian Football Federation (FECAFOOT), Samuel Eto’o, continues to be talked about, on the occasion of the 33rd edition of the African Cup of Nations which showed setbacks, some of them very serious , since the opening match on January 9. 

This time, these are warlike remarks having no connection with the sportsmanship which must nevertheless prevail during competitions. The Egyptian coach, whose team is preparing to face Cameroon in the semi-finals, did not miss the former Barça star.

For the president of FECAFOOT, the CAN semi-final match, which the Indomitable Lions will play on Thursday February 3 against the Pharaohs of Egypt, is a “war”. It was enough for the coach of Egypt, the Portuguese Carlos Queiroz, to denounce the remarks described as unfortunate and a very bad message. Once again, the words of Samuel Eto’o, spoken in the locker room at the end of the quarter-final match won against Gambia, did not go unnoticed.

“ Get ready because it will be war ”

What angered the Egyptian coach was the warrior remarks of the former FC Barcelona player on the Cameroon-Egypt match counting for the semi-final of CAN 2021. A video from the Cameroonian Federation shows Samuel Eto ‘o in the locker room galvanizing the players after their victory in the quarter-finals, and this, in the locker room of the stadium where the Cameroon-Gambia meeting took place.

The president of FECAFOOT skidded during his intervention when he qualified the next match against Egypt as a war. ” Guys, everything you’ve done, you have to do it on Thursday! With the same mentality, get ready because it will be war! War, guys! That’s how we should approach this game! The war ! “, indeed declared Samuel Eto’o in front of the players of the Cameroon team, just after congratulating them for their qualification against Gambia.

Eto’o ” forgot that Cameroonians died at the stadium “

But for Egypt coach Carlos Queiroz, this slippage has not fallen on deaf ears. He did not fail to denounce “unfortunate” remarks and “a very bad message to the Cameroonian people”. ” I think he forgot that Cameroonians died at the stadium several days ago, and so to make this declaration of war before a match shows that he has learned nothing from his time in professional football,” said assaulted the former coach of several European clubs, including Manchester United and Real Madrid.

The coach of the Pharaohs of Egypt considers that “it was a very, very unfortunate comment, because football is not a war, it is a celebration, joy and happiness. We will respond to war with football, we will respond to football with joy. We are here to please people, not to kill them, but to give them pleasure and joy,” he added with great bitterness.

It is important to remember that for this new edition of the African Cup which has experienced many setbacks , Egypt qualified for the last four of CAN 2021 after its victory (2-1) against the selection of Morocco that directs the former coach of Algeria, the Franco-Bosnian Vahid Halilhodzic. For its part, the selection of Cameroon eliminated the Scorpions of Gambia, by 2 goals to 0. This Egypt-Cameroon match is considered a real final before the letter, compared to the other semi-final which will oppose, this Wednesday 2 February, Senegal to Burkina Faso.
